Metalloids Are Found Where On The Periodic Table. the term is normally applied to a group of between six and nine elements (boron, silicon, germanium, arsenic,. Metalloids can also be called semimetals. The line begins below boron (b) and extends between. a metalloid is an element that has properties that are intermediate between those of metals and nonmetals. a series of six elements called the metalloids separate the metals from the nonmetals in the periodic table. Elements to the left of the line are considered metals. the metalloids separate the metals and nonmetals on a periodic table. The line begins at boron (b) and extends to polonium (po).
